Decade path · College Scorecard
Average net price fell on both sides
BOTH-NET-DOWN · 2013–2023
Fitted net-price slopes at Dallas College and City Colleges of Chicago-Kennedy-King College both decline over 2013–2023. Sticker tuition can still rise while the aided Title IV cohort average moves the other way, this board is about the aided average.
- City Colleges of Chicago-Kennedy-King College: average net price fell -42.4% from $8,515 (2013) to $4,902 (2023), r² 0.59.
- Dallas College: average net price fell -31.3% from $6,033 (2013) to $4,146 (2023), r² 0.58.
- Dallas College: enrollment grew +372.3% over 2013–2023; fitted +4,244 students/yr fitted, r² 0.66.
- City Colleges of Chicago-Kennedy-King College: enrollment shrank -65.3% over 2013–2023; fitted -305 students/yr fitted, r² 0.81.
College Scorecard institution series; dollars are nominal. Direction claims require r² ≥ 0.40 on the fitted annual slope, otherwise the page reports the observed range. Descriptive history, not a recommendation.

| Metric | Dallas College Dallas, TX | City Colleges of Chicago-Kennedy-King College Chicago, IL |
| Location | Dallas, TX | Chicago, IL |
| Undergraduate Enrollment | 43,869 | 1,777 |
| Avg Net Price | $3,214 | $9,494 |
| Out-of-State Tuition | $6,900 | $15,150 |
| In-State Tuition | $2,730 | $4,590 |
| Median Earnings (6 yr) | $35,493 | $22,119 |
| Median Debt at Graduation | $9,500 | $6,180 |
| Median Earnings (10 yr) | $41,714 | $28,467 |
| 150%-Time Completion | 34.0% | 28.9% |
Rows ordered by relative gap on this pair. Teal = better side. College Scorecard.
